BioNTech SE Sponsored ADR (NASDAQ:BNTX – Get Free Report) CEO Ugur Sahin sold 34,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Thursday, September 17th. The stock was sold at an average price of $98.60, for a total transaction of $3,352,400.00. Following the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 519,209 shares in the company, valued at approximately $51,194,007.40. The trade was a 6.15%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

About BioNTech
BioNTech SE is a biotechnology company focused on developing immunotherapies and vaccines for cancer and other serious diseases. Its research platforms include messenger RNA, cell therapies, protein-based therapeutics, antibody therapies and small-molecule immunomodulators.
The company is best known for Comirnaty, its COVID-19 vaccine developed and commercialized globally in collaboration with Pfizer. BioNTech is also advancing a broad oncology pipeline that includes individualized and off-the-shelf cancer vaccines, antibody-based treatments, cell therapies and combination approaches designed to stimulate or direct the immune system against tumors.
BioNTech was founded in 2008 and is headquartered in Mainz, Germany.
